Baby Lemon Impossible Pies That Taste Like Magic

Baby Lemon Impossible Pies are mini, magical treats combining a creamy custard center with a naturally formed crust. Tangy lemon flavor and sweet texture make them perfect bite-sized desserts.

  • Total Time: 35-40 minutes
  • Yield: 12 pies 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 cup sugar
  • 1/4 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 tsp baking powder
  • 1 cup milk (any type)
  • 2 tbsp fresh lemon juice
  • 1 tsp lemon zest
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• Pinch of salt
  • Powdered sugar for dusting
  • Fresh berries for garnish (optional)

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ease or line a muffin tin with paper liners.
  2. Whisk eggs, sugar, flour, and baking powder until smooth. Add milk, lemon juice, zest, vanilla, and salt; mix well.
  3. Pour batter into muffin cups about 3/4 full.
  4. Bake 25–30 minutes until golden and a toothpick comes out clean.
  5. Cool slightly, remove from tin, dust with powdered sugar, and garnish with fresh berries if desired.

Notes

  • Use fresh lemon juice and zest for optimal flavor.
  • Do not overfill muffin cups; fill only 3/4 full to prevent overflow.
  • Let pies cool before removing from tin to set properly.
